This is a pilot study of radiotherapy using Hypofractionated image – guided helical
tomotherapy after hyperbaric oxygen HBO therapy for treatment of recurrent malignant
High-grade gliomas. HBO therapy will be perform in conjunction with each RT session.
The treatment scheme is:
Hyperbaric oxygenation therapy (the maximum period of time from completion of decompression
to RT is 60 min) followed by tomotherapy (3-5 consecutive sessions- one fraction per day , 5
Gy / die ).
The trial will enroll 24 patients in 24 months with a follow-up period of 1 year.
